Would like to share some Robin Hood Rifles badges that I was fortunate to pick up from Les Martin kindly via Paul Spellman.

They are:

Two Robin Hood Rifles GM glengarry badges dating 1874-1902 and worn on the side cap from 1895. Replaced with King's Crown version worn 1902-1905 on the glengarry badge and on the Bush Hat in South Africa. Blackened versions noted.

A Robin Hood Rifles blackened pouch badge with 3 screw fittings 1874-1902. 7.5 x 6.5cm

A Robin Hood Rifles Dress Cap KC badge in blackened metal for Rifleman. 1905-1908. Silver for Officers and WM for NCOs.

Bandsmans Cross Belt KC badge in WM with single screw fitting for the 7th (Robin Hoods) Battalion Sherwood Foresters - 1908-1953. Cap badges noted in silver for Officers, blackened for ORs and BM for NCOs.

Pair of T 7 Notts & Derby shoulder titles Gaunt marked and a single unmarked T 7 Notts & Derby shoulder title. White metal versions are known.
